Output eab85eaa8a74eb76fdfd97e4c4acfa25d12601a9134063b95a751b74a03994bc:0

value
292104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1eb9cf296722fb40717a039bda53a0f71a29f04 OP_EQUAL
address
3PkB2TYTbau5ENoGCSXFk9xhcDfAjSFWTJ
transaction
eab85eaa8a74eb76fdfd97e4c4acfa25d12601a9134063b95a751b74a03994bc
confirmations
263327
spent
true